Horse racing icon Rachael Blackmore to visit Westgate Oxford

Westgate Oxford is set to host Irish jockey Rachael Blackmore as she meets shoppers in Middle Square this Saturday, 7th February.
Widely regarded as the Queen of Horse Racing, Rachael is the first female jockey to win both the Boodles Cheltenham Gold Cup and the Randox Grand National and is now one of the most recognisable and respected figures in the sport.
On a mission to inspire the next generation of racing fans, Rachael has teamed up with The Jockey Club as Head of Ladies’ Day at Cheltenham Racecourse and is committed to engage more women with the sport she owes her career to.
The Westgate Oxford stop is part of a three-city UK roadshow taking place ahead of The Cheltenham Festival. The roadshow aims to celebrate inclusivity in sport, inspire future generations, and give racing fans a first look at what’s new for Ladies Day at The Cheltenham Festival 2026, which returns on Wednesday 11th March.
Rachael will be attending Westgate Oxford event from 12pm to 3pm, taking part in meet-and-greet sessions and engaging with members of the public. Complimentary hair and make-up experiences will also be on offer to those attending the event, delivered by an expert team at the Debenhams Day Spa.
